Position Summary
The Senior Director, HCP Marketing leads and drives the enterprise HCP marketing strategy and execution to support brand commercialization across all channels.

Primary Responsibilities
- Own and drive enterprise-level HCP brand strategy; ensure alignment across community sales, LTC, and non-personal promotion.
- Lead cross-functional brand planning with Sales, Market Access, Medical Affairs, and Commercial Operations.
- Evolve brand strategy and messaging using clinical data, market insights, and competitive intelligence.
- Provide strategic oversight to the HCP marketing team (including leading/developing team members).
- Own peer-to-peer strategy and execution for healthcare professional engagement.
- Lead integrated marketing across channels (HCP promotion, digital strategy, media planning, field enablement).
- Partner with Sales leadership to align marketing strategy with field execution and performance objectives.
- Oversee planning/execution of commercial initiatives (conventions, exhibits, strategic marketing programs).
- Build/manage KOL relationships and lead KOL engagement strategy.
- Lead advisory board strategy and execution with Medical Affairs.
- Oversee performance measurement and optimization of marketing activities.
- Manage significant HCP marketing budget.
- Identify market opportunities and competitive threats; adjust strategy proactively.
- Ensure compliance with Medical, Legal, and Regulatory requirements and company policies.
- Lead agency strategy and management.

Education/Experience (Required)
- Bachelor’s degree in marketing/healthcare/business administration or related field; MBA preferred.
- 12+ years progressive pharmaceutical/biotech marketing experience; leadership experience required (leading teams and/or complex cross-functional initiatives).

Preferred
- Neurology or specialty therapeutic experience.
- Enterprise-level strategic experience in commercial organizations.

Required Skills
- Biopharmaceutical brand marketing and multi-channel strategy expertise.
- Ability to influence/align senior leadership.
- Strategic thinking; translate insights into business outcomes.
- Cross-functional collaboration; executive communication presence.
- Lead in fast-paced, matrixed environment.
- Strong financial acumen; manage large budgets.
- Travel up to 40%.
